I’m building Lolmao.​Io, a 2D online sandbox inspired by Pixel Worlds that lets players build, chat, trade and fully customise their avatars. The core loops, monetisation model (Pixel Pass plus in-game currency) and a detailed design document are already in place; what I need now is solid game development muscle to turn those plans into a playable PC experience.

Scope of work
• Set up a client-server architecture that supports real-time multiplayer in large, persistent worlds.
• Implement core gameplay systems: block placement & removal, avatar movement, chat, trading and basic crafting.
• Create a simple account/login flow tied to cloud-saved inventories.
• Integrate placeholder art so we can iterate quickly; final graphics will be added later.
• Build hooks for the Pixel Pass and virtual-currency store (no payment SDKs yet, just the stubs).

Tech notes
I’m engine-agnostic—Unity, Unreal, Godot or something custom is fine as long as it reliably hits 60 fps on mid-range PCs and can be exported to Web or Mobile later. Use whatever networking stack you’re most comfortable with; just outline why it suits a 2D MMO.

Deliverables
1. A working pre-alpha build for Windows (.exe) with a hosted test server.
2. Source project with clear folder structure, commented code and setup instructions.
3. Short README describing engine version, third-party libraries and build steps.

Acceptance criteria
• Up to 50 concurrent players can join the same world, place/remove blocks and see others’ actions in real time with <150 ms latency.
• Chat, trading and inventory persist across sessions.
• Pixel Pass and currency UI paths are reachable, even if they point to stub logic for now.
